Abstract
Un objetivo de la presente invención es proporcionar un troquel de flexión que tiene una configuración simple y que es capaz de doblar un cuerpo en forma de varilla en una dirección XYZ tridimensional de manera rápida y confiable, el troquel de flexión comprende un par de troqueles formadores 10, 20 acoplados en una dirección Z, en donde los troqueles formadores tienen, respectivamente, porciones de hendidura formadora de cuerpo en forma de varilla 11, 21, y porciones guía del cuerpo en forma de varilla 12, 22 para guiar un cuerpo en forma de varilla hacia las porciones de hendidura formadoras del cuerpo en forma de varilla, cada una de las porciones de hendidura formadora del cuerpo en forma de varilla están formadas en una forma con una sección transversal semicircular que define, entre los troqueles formadores cuando los troqueles formadores están acoplados, una cavidad cilíndrica larga para formar el cuerpo en forma de varilla doblado en una dirección XYZ tridimensional, y cada una de las porciones guía del cuerpo en forma de varilla están formadas en una forma en V que se extiende hacia afuera desde ambos lados de cada una de las porciones de hendidura formadora del cuerpo en forma de varilla que tienen una sección transversal semicircular.
